Output 79d3ca192316c988cd7efe1ef3b1c56b29073e2fe13afe8d930dbf16cb1e6a54:0

value
1132437538
script pubkey
OP_0 OP_PUSHBYTES_20 af2dc8d28d7df321dae367522367f4051e4a474f
address
tb1q4uku355d0hejrkhrvafzxel5q50y5360x6h8kk
transaction
79d3ca192316c988cd7efe1ef3b1c56b29073e2fe13afe8d930dbf16cb1e6a54
confirmations
54677
spent
true